What are the three main modes of heat transfer?

Back

Conduction, Convection, and Radiation.

What is conduction?

Back

Conduction is the transfer of heat through a material without the movement of the material itself, typically occurring in solids.

What is convection?

Back

Convection is the transfer of heat through the movement of fluids (liquids or gases) caused by differences in temperature and density.

What is radiation?

Back

Radiation is the transfer of heat in the form of electromagnetic waves, which can occur in a vacuum.

Which surface is best for absorbing heat radiation?

Back

Dull black surfaces are the best for absorbing heat radiation.
